Default Boat trailer help

Well I got rear ended pulling my boat a couple of weeks ago. Thankfully hardly any damage to boat/trailer. Had to get my winch post welded back on which was about the extent of it all. Finally getting around to setting it up how it was and now there is about a 2in gap between the front bunk board and my hull. I don't believe the trailer is bent or twisted somehow but something had to change. Should I just add to the front bunk board so it'll help support the hull ? Or maybe lower my back bunks and get them even with the front ?
